Mission and Program Overview

Mission

Sumc is working to replace car-centric transportation with people-focused shared mobility to fight climate change, promote equity, and strengthen community. Sumc is a public-interest organization dedicated to achieving equitable, affordable, and environmentally sound mobility across the us through the efficient sharing of transportation assets. By connecting the public and private sectors, piloting programs, conducting new research, and providing policy and technical expertise to cities and regions, sumc seeks to extend the benefits of shared mobility for all.

Shared-use mobility center was organized to engage in research concerning mobility choices for people and communities within the united states, including the development, expansion, and integration of technologies; publication of scholarly works and creation of practical resource guides; creation of a library through which the work products of the center can be disseminated to the public; creation of a forum through which the work of the center, together with such of other thought leaders, can be shared and discussed; and, further facilitate and encourage public discourse.

Governance Explanations

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 4

The organization's by-laws were revised in april 2024. The significant changes include prohibiting the ceo from also serving as secretary or treasurer, updating the description of secretary and treasurer responsibilities, and adding a conflict of interest and notice section.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 11B

The draft 990 is reviewed by the treasurer and the final 990 is circulated to the board with the final financial statements before filing.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 12C

Board members are required to disclose when potential conflicts arise and the organization attempts to have the board members sign off that they understand the policy on an annual basis. Any conflicts are discussed at a board meeting and dealt with accordingly.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 15A

The executive director's salary is reveiwed by a board committee consisting of 3 board members,including the chair. This process was documented and the salary amount approved by the board. There are no other compensated officers or key employees.

Financial Statement Notes

PART X, LINE 2:

The center follows the guidance in the fasb codification topic related to uncertainty in income taxes which prescribes a comprehensive model for recognizing, measuring, presenting and disclosing in the financial statements uncertain tax positions that the organization has taken or expects to take in its tax returns. Under the guidance, the organization may recognize the tax benefit from an uncertain tax position only if it is "more likely than not" that it is sustainable, based on its technical merits. The tax benefits recognized in the financial statements from such a position should be measured based on the largest benefit that has a greater than 50% likelihood of being realized upon ultimate settlement with a taxing authority having full knowledge of all relevant information. The center believes that it has appropriate support for the positions taken on its returns.
